During his stay in Shirdi, Moreshwar explored the various places associated with Sai Baba. He visited Dwarkamai, the mosque where Baba resided and imparted his teachings. The Chavadi, where Baba spent alternate nights, also held a special significance for Moreshwar, as he learned about the routine and lifestyle of Sai Baba.

In the days that followed, Moreshwar immersed himself in the spiritual practices prevalent in Shirdi. He participated in the aarti (ritualistic worship) and attended discourses on Sai Baba’s life and teachings. He also engaged in seva (selfless service) at the temple, cherishing the opportunity to contribute to the divine cause.
